> >> Hi Milan, it sounds like you are attempting to run the test-suite from

> >>

> >> the SUnit Tests browser. The Magma test suite is not initiated this

> >>

> >> way due to limitations of SUnit framework. Instead, you just execute

> >>

> >> in a workspace:

> >>

> >>

> >>

> >> MagmaTestCase kickoff

> >>

> >>

> >>

> >> This, along with other information about the Magma test cases can be

> >>

> >> found in the documentation.
